Role overview

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ust is hiring a Personal Assistant/Project Support Officer for the Forensic Directorate on a 14-month fixed-term contract to cover maternity leave. This post is central to helping the Director of Forensic Mental Health coordinate directorate priorities, strategy, and day-to-day operational activity.

The position combines high-level diary and communications support with project coordination across workstreams in the Forensic Directorate. It requires excellent organisation, the ability to juggle several priorities at once, and the confidence to keep multiple tasks moving forward to deadline.

To succeed in this role, you will need to communicate clearly, build strong working relationships, and work with a high degree of accuracy, sound judgement, and attention to detail.

Key duties

  • Deliver full administrative and project support to the Director of Forensic Mental Health, serving as a first point of contact and handling communications with discretion and strict confidentiality.
  • Manage a busy and complex diary, arrange meetings and events, and make sure agendas, papers, and minutes are prepared and circulated on time and without errors.
  • Assist with planning, tracking, monitoring, and reporting on Directorate priorities and project workstreams so that deadlines are met and progress is clearly recorded.
  • Prepare reports, briefing notes, and presentations, and maintain robust systems for information handling and document control.
  • Work effectively with internal teams and external contacts, maintaining productive relationships through strong inter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Work independently to organise your workload, adapt to shifting demands, and put efficient processes in place that support service delivery.
  • Provide leadership and line-management support to administrative colleagues, helping with team development, service improvement, and the delivery of accurate work in line with organisational policy and governance standards.

Additional requirements

The ability to travel independently between sites within the Trust is essential.

About the organisation

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ust provides physical health, mental health, and social care services for people of all ages across Oxfordshire, Buckinghamshire, Swindon, Wiltshire, Bath, and North East Somerset. Care is delivered through community bases, hospitals, clinics, and people’s homes, with the aim of providing support as close to home as possible.

The Trust’s vision is to deliver outstanding care through an outstanding team, and its values are caring, safe, and excellent.
